Introduction:

In the present fast-paced world, the standard 9-5 work schedule not any longer pertains to many people. Because of the increase of dual-income homes and non-traditional work hours, the demand for 24-hour daycare services happens to be ste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ers offer parents the flexibility they have to stabilize work and household obligations, and provide a secure and nurturing environment for kids night and day.

The key great things about 24-hour daycare is the versatility it gives working parents. Numerous parents work changes that stretch beyond old-fashioned daycare hours, making it difficult to acquire childcare that suits their schedule. 24-hour daycare centers solve this problem by giving treatment during evenings, vacations, and also in a single day. This enables moms and dads to operate without worrying all about finding someone to view kids during non-traditional hours.

Another benefit of 24-hour daycare could be the reassurance it gives to parents. Comprehending that their children are now being taken care of by trained experts in a safe and safe environment can alleviate the tension and guilt that often includes making young ones in daycare. Moms and dads can consider their particular work comprehending that kids come in good hands, that could induce increased productivity and job pleasure.

In addition, 24-hour daycare centers can provide a sense of neighborhood and assistance for households. Moms and dads which work non-traditional hours often struggle to discover childcare choices that meet their needs, resulting in feelings of separation and anxiety. 24-hour daycare centers can offer a feeling of belonging and camaraderie among moms and dads dealing with similar difficulties, creating a support network that will help households th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are Near Me: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er many benefits, in addition they have their particular group of challenges. One of the greatest challenges is staffing. Finding qualified and reliable childcare providers who will be happy to work non-traditional hours may be hard, ultimately causing high return rates and prospective staffing shortages. This might impact the caliber of attention supplied to young ones and create instability for households depending on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the cost. Supplying care 24 hours a day needs extra staffing and resources, that may drive within the cost of services. This is often a barrier for low-income people who is almost certainly not able to manage 24-hour daycare, making these with limited al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

Being ensure the protection and well being of children in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and supervision are crucial. State and regional governments set requirements for certification and accreditation of daycare facilities, including those who function round the clock. These criteria cover a wide range of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ices needs, and staff education and skills.

In addition to government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ities elect to look for accreditation from national businesses including the nationwide Association when it comes to knowledge of young kids (NAEYC) or even the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a consignment to top-quality attention and can assist moms and dads feel confident inside their chosen childcare supplier.
